RSA 358-A:8 Subpoena; Production of Books, Examination of Persons, Etc.
Title: XXXI - TRADE AND COMMERCE
Chapter: 358-A - REGULATION OF BUSINESS PRACTICES FOR CONSUMER PROTECTION
I.
Authority of Attorney General. The attorney general shall have the power to subpoena and subpoena duces tecum in the name of the attorney general for the purposes of this chapter. Witnesses summoned by the attorney general shall be paid the same fee and mileage that are paid witnesses in the superior court of the state. A subpoena or subpoena duces tecum of the attorney general may be served by any person designated in the subpoena or subpoena duces tecum to serve it. The attorney general may administer an oath or affirmation to any person and conduct hearings in aid of any investigation.
